Traditional authorities are also custodians of land and will play an important role in this project."}, {"bbox": [97, 340, 1134, 554], "category": "Text", "text": "The **private sector** working in the sanitation/liquid waste management value chain will be the **other main direct beneficiary** of the project with the MMDAs and will be the one implementing the services in this area. The project will develop its capacities and support it through innovative financing to put in place a virtuous and efficient circular economy solutions from toilets to any bio-products being produced from faecal sludge (biofertilizer, biochar, fish feed, water reuse, etc...). The private sector will play a key role in the execution of works to build faecal sludge management plants, toilets, flood control mechanisms. Private sector operators will also be involved in other urban activities and services like the one that will be implemented in the non-buildable areas and other nature-based solutions (urban agriculture, etc...), or the faecal sludge management plants operations."}, {"bbox": [97, 579, 1134, 632], "category": "Text", "text": "Having their living conditions improved, **Residents/Citizens, including women, children, persons with disabilities and other vulnerable groups of these 6 urban areas will be the final beneficiaries** of this action."}, {"bbox": [86, 660, 604, 692], "category": "Section-header", "text": "# 3 DESCRIPTION OF THE ACTION"}, {"bbox": [86, 726, 508, 757], "category": "Section-header", "text": "## 3.1 Objectives and Expected Outputs"}, {"bbox": [97, 772, 956, 800], "category": "Text", "text": "The **Overall Objective** of this action is to improve urban sustainability and prosperity for all."}, {"bbox": [97, 825, 517, 852], "category": "Text", "text": "**The Specific Objectives** of this action are to:"}, {"bbox": [97, 853, 1134, 932], "category": "Text", "text": "SO1: Increase sustainable, equitable and inclusive access to sanitation and hygiene services through enhanced local capacity, private sector development and employment, with a specific focus on women in all their diversity and most marginalised groups in Wa, Bolgatanga, Tamale, Nalerigu, Damongo and Yendi"}, {"bbox": [97, 932, 928, 959], "category": "Text", "text": "SO2: Strengthen urban resilience to adapt to risks of climate change in Tamale particularly"}, {"bbox": [97, 985, 385, 1011], "category": "Text", "text": "**Outputs contributing to SO1:**"}, {"bbox": [97, 1011, 1134, 1063], "category": "Text", "text": "1.1 Contributing to Outcome 1 (or Specific Objective 1): Five faecal sludge treatments facilities are built, operated and financially and environmentally sustainable in Wa, Bolgatanga, Yendi, Damongo and Nalerigu"}, {"bbox": [97, 1064, 1134, 1117], "category": "Text", "text": "1.2 Contributing to Outcome 1 (or Specific Objective 1): The capacity of the private sector to meet the demand and quality requirements for sanitation, hygiene and liquid waste management services is strengthened"}, {"bbox": [97, 1117, 1134, 1170], "category": "Text", "text": "1.3 Contributing to Outcome 1 (or Specific Objective 1): Local bodies capacity to facilitate and regulate inclusive, quality, and sustainable liquid waste service delivery is improved"}, {"bbox": [97, 1170, 1134, 1250], "category": "Text", "text": "1.4 Contributing to Outcome 1 (or Specific Objective 1): Access to finance for households (prioritising female-headed and households with disabled family members), SMEs and LMEs for sanitation/liquid waste management and water services are improved"}, {"bbox": [97, 1276, 385, 1303], "category": "Text", "text": "**Outputs contributing to SO2:**"}, {"bbox": [97, 1303, 1134, 1355], "category": "Text", "text": "2.1 Contributing to Outcome 2 (or Specific Objective 2): Resilient urban infrastructures are developed as to increase climate change adaptation in the most needed areas"}, {"bbox": [97, 1355, 1134, 1408], "category": "Text", "text": "2.2 Contributing to Outcome 2 (or Specific Objective 2): Governance in Tamale is improved as to better anticipate and respond to the adverse effects of climate change, including by engaging with civil society"}, {"bbox": [97, 1408, 1134, 1488], "category": "Text", "text": "2.3 Contributing to Outcome 2 (or Specific Objective 2): Sustainable nature-based solutions and public spaces are developed and secured with the public and the private sectors, as to increase climate change adaptation and inclusivity"}, {"bbox": [86, 1503, 367, 1530], "category": "Section-header", "text": "## 3.2 Indicative Activities"}, {"bbox": [97, 1549, 396, 1575], "category": "Text", "text": "Activities relating to Output 1.1:"}, {"bbox": [135, 1576, 641, 1603], "category": "List-item", "text": "* Construction of 5 faecal sludge treatment facilities:"}, {"bbox": [209, 1603, 732, 1630], "category": "List-item", "text": "  * 3 large scale facilities in Wa, Bolgatanga and Yendi"}, {"bbox": [1027, 1681, 1144, 1706], "category": "Page-footer", "text": "Page 11 of 30"}]
